Is tuna good after surgery?
Fish is also high in zinc and Omega 3 fatty acids, both very important to the body, particularly during the healing process. Wild caught salmon and tuna are some of the Omega 3 powerhouses but other types of seafood contain zinc so go ahead and mix it up. Highly processed foodsSome of the foods you need to avoid after surgery are those that are highly processed. Not only are they usually low in fiber (which can cause constipation), but in most cases, they also lack the nutrients your body needs to heal.

Protein-rich foodIt is important to eat an adequate amount of protein after surgery as your body requires more protein for wound healing. Protein also helps to build your muscles and improve the immune system. Examples of protein sources include: Lean meat, skinless poultry, fish.

What fish is good for wound healing?
Snakehead fish (Channa striatus) is a fresh water fish indigenous to many Asia countries and believed to have medical value. Protein is especially important after surgery. It helps repair damaged body tissues, form antibodies to fight infections, and synthesize collagen which is necessary for scar formation. What foods fill wounds?
Foods containing protein and the suggested vitamins and minerals needed for wound healing include:
- Protein: Meat, fish, eggs, beans, milk, yogurt (particularly Greek), tofu, and soy protein products.
- Vitamin A: Carrots, orange and dark green leafy vegetables, fortified dairy products, cereals, and liver.
